Where Does Coffee Come From

Coffee comes from a coffee plant, which is a small evergreen bush that grows in tropical and subtropical regions of the world. Beans of coffee come from the coffee cherries of the coffee plant. What do coffee beans grow on?

Coffee beans grow on coffee plants, which are part of the Rubiaceae family. Coffee plants are grown in many tropical and sub-tropical areas around the world. What are the 4 types of coffee beans?

Coffee beans are the seeds of the coffee cherry, the fruit of the coffee plant. Green coffee beans are popularly thought to be unroasted coffee seeds, but this is not strictly true, because the seeds are actually the coffee cherries after removing the fruit pulp. Green coffee beans are typically roasted soon before they are brewed into coffee. The 2 main types of coffee beans are Arabica and Robusta. Arabica beans are grown in higher altitudes and are considered to be of better quality than Robusta, which are grown at lower altitudes. Arabica beans are also priced higher than Robusta..
